Crache ton venin is an album[1].
Key Facts
- Crache ton venin's instance of is recorded as album[2].
- Crache ton venin's genre is rock music[3].
- Crache ton venin was produced by Martin Rushent[4].
- Among the performers on Crache ton venin was Téléphone[5].
- Crache ton venin's record label is recorded as EMI Pathé Marconi S.A.[6].
- Crache ton venin's place of publication is recorded as France[7].
- Crache ton venin is part of Téléphone's albums in chronological order[8].
- Crache ton venin's language of work or name is recorded as French[9].
- Crache ton venin was distributed by vinyl record[10].
- Crache ton venin was distributed by compact disc[11].
- Crache ton venin was distributed by music streaming[12].
- Crache ton venin was released on April 2, 1979[13].
- Crache ton venin's tracklist is recorded as La Bombe humaine[14].
- Crache ton venin's tracklist is recorded as Un peu de ton amour[15].
- Crache ton venin's tracklist is recorded as Tu vas me manquer[16].
